3. Weaknesses & Limitations
- Shallow Depth: Does not explain fault diagnosis, troubleshooting, or maintenance procedures. For example, it shows the hydraulic reservoirs but not how to pressurize them.
- Outdated Information: Many free PDFs found online date from 2005–2012. They may reference older FMS (FMGC) standards, CRT displays instead of LCD, or missing NEO/Sharklet details.
- No Interactive Elements: Unlike modern e-learning modules, a static PDF cannot simulate switch sequencing or ECAM actions.
- Generic Nature: Some PDFs combine CEO and NEO data poorly, leading to confusion about engine-specific differences.
